How they compare
Singapore currently reports -3.92 % change on previous year against -4.78 % change on previous year in Namibia, a difference of 0.86 % change on previous year.
The two have swapped places 12 times across 24 shared years of data; in 2001 it was Singapore ahead.
Namibia ranks 110th and Singapore ranks 107th of 204 countries.
Namibia has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
